Doesn't matter. We need the tomcat.exe and tomcatw.exe only.
While the tomcat.exe could be compiled using cygwin or mingw, there is a
problem with tomcatw.exe. The GNU's resource compilers doesn't handle
the
BITMAP resources so we are missing those whenever building with those
tools.
Also I'm not sure about the License and Cygwin binaries (that's too
fuzzy, so I don't even bother to compile something with cygwin).

AFAICT we don't build WIN32 distributable binaries with those tools for
any j-t-c project.
